Transaction 5759e3adba16e23c2665611bf68a56ecfbb8d57f61f354146c94b8282806dac5
1 Input
1 Output
-
5759e3adba16e23c2665611bf68a56ecfbb8d57f61f354146c94b8282806dac5:0
- value
- 526135
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2686ac7ffaa51f14b8e5531bcae9dbbdc7d5e84f OP_EQUALVERIFY OP_CHECKSIG
- address
- 14Wi1bHeiAFQ8hQWicDd77VCTLaKReDH6M